从零开始:理解IP池与爬虫的关系
很多刚接触网络数据采集的朋友,都会遇到一个头疼的问题:目标网站怎么没抓几次数据就把我封了?这背后往往是你的操作被识别为“非正常访问”。一个固定的IP地址频繁请求,就像同一个人反复敲门,被拒绝是迟早的事。这时,代理IP的作用就凸显出来了。它相当于一个中间人,用它的地址去帮你敲门,从而隐藏你的真实来源。而IP池,就是由大量这样的代理IP地址组成的资源集合。当你在进行大规模、长时间的数据采集时,通过轮换使用池子里的不同IP,可以有效模拟来自全球不同地区的正常用户访问,大幅降低被封锁的风险,提升数据获取的效率和稳定性。
开源利器:搭建自己的IP收集与验证系统
对于新手而言,直接购买商业IP池可能成本较高,且想了解其中原理。利用一些免费开源项目搭建一个初具规模的IP池,是绝佳的学习和实践途径。核心思路分为三步:采集、验证、维护。
是IP的采集。网络上存在许多公开的免费代理IP网站,会定期发布一些可用的代理地址。你可以编写简单的脚本,定时从这些页面抓取新发布的IP和端口信息。这里的关键是“广撒网”,来源越多,初始的基数就越大。
也是最核心的一步——验证。从公开渠道获得的IP,绝大部分可能是无效、不稳定或速度极慢的。你需要一个验证程序来筛选。验证的原理很简单:用采集到的代理IP去访问一个稳定的、能够返回你访问者IP的网站(例如一些提供“查看我的IP”服务的网站),如果能够成功返回数据,并且返回的IP正是你使用的代理IP,同时响应速度在可接受范围内,那么这个代理就是初步可用的。你需要将验证通过的IP存入你的数据库或文件中,形成初步的可用IP池。
最后是维护。代理IP具有时效性,特别是免费资源,可能几十分钟甚至几分钟后就失效了。你需要定期(例如每隔15-30分钟)对池中的IP进行再次验证,剔除失效的,补充新采集的,形成一个动态更新的循环,这样才能保证池子的活性。
方案升级:构建稳定高效的千万级数据架构
当你的基础IP池运转起来后,可能会发现免费IP的可用率低、速度慢、维护成本高,难以支撑千万级数据量的业务需求。架构需要升级。你可以将IP池设计为多层级结构:
第一层:高速验证网关。 负责快速初筛新采集的IP,判断其基本连通性。
第二层:质量评估层。 对初步可用的IP进行深度测试,包括访问目标网站的成功率、响应、匿名度(是否暴露了你在使用代理)等,并根据得分将IP分为不同质量等级(如高速、稳定、普通)。
第三层:业务调度层。 根据不同的数据采集任务(如对速度要求高的,或对稳定性要求高的),从对应等级的IP池中调度IP使用,并在IP失效时自动切换。
要实现千万级IP池的管理,一个可靠的数据库(如Redis,因其高速读写特性非常适合存储IP状态信息)和一套任务调度系统是必不可少的。这能将IP的采集、验证、分类、分配、失效剔除全部自动化,形成一个庞大的动态IP代理网络。
超越开源:专业代理IP服务的价值
尽管自建IP池富有挑战和学习乐趣,但当业务步入正轨,对数据采集的稳定性、速度、合规性提出更高要求时,自建体系的短板就会显现:IP纯净度难以保障、维护投入巨大、全球覆盖网络搭建困难。这时,选择专业的代理IP服务就成了更优解。
以神龙海外动态IP为例,它能直接提供你梦寐以求的“千万级IP池”。其核心价值在于:
资源海量且纯净: 拥有超过9000万的庞大IP资源库,并且通过技术结合人工实时去重与更新,确保IP的高度纯净与合规,省去了你筛选和维护的工作。
高带宽与稳定性: 针对大规模、持续性的数据采集业务,提供高带宽且不限量的代理IP支持,保障高并发请求下的长期稳定运行,这是自建免费IP池难以企及的。
精准的全球覆盖: 其代理IP覆盖全球200多个国家和地区。无论你需要模拟哪个地区的用户访问以进行搜索引擎优化,还是需要获取特定市场的电子商务价格数据,都能找到精准的地理位置IP。
多场景专项方案: 提供包括动态住宅IP、数据中心IP在内的多种代理方案。例如,对于需要更高匿名性和真实用户模拟的场景,其动态住宅IP代理更为合适;而对于需要经济高效处理大量请求的场景,数据中心IP则是优选。其企业级代理IP池更能满足高标准业务需求。
更重要的是,它支持HTTP、HTTPS、SOCKS5多种代理协议,能无缝集成到你现有的采集架构中,为你的数据采集、市场调研、品牌保护乃至AI大模型训练的数据准备阶段,提供稳定、可靠的基础设施支持。
常见问题QA
Q:免费代理和像神龙海外动态IP这样的付费代理,本质区别是什么?
A: 本质区别在于资源质量、稳定性、维护责任和合规性。免费代理IP大多是公开共享的,用户多、速度慢、失效快、匿名性差,且可能携带安全风险。而专业服务商提供的代理IP是独享或小范围共享的优质资源,拥有高速带宽、高可用率、专业团队维护保障纯净与稳定,并承担合规责任,让你能专注于业务本身。
Q:我应该如何选择代理IP的类型(住宅IP vs 数据中心IP)?
A: 这取决于你的目标网站的反爬策略。如果目标网站防护较弱,追求性价比和速度,数据中心IP是首选。如果目标网站对IP识别严格,需要模拟真实用户行为(如社交媒体数据收集、复杂电商平台),那么来自真实家庭宽带网络的住宅IP代理或动态住宅IP更难被封锁,成功率更高。
Q:使用代理IP进行数据采集是否合法?
A: 代理IP技术本身是中性的。其合法性完全取决于你的使用目的和方式。务必遵守目标网站的Robots协议,尊重版权和隐私,将采集速率控制在不对对方服务器造成压力的合理范围内,用于合法的市场调研、公开信息分析等目的。任何违反法律法规和网站规定的行为都是不可取的。
Q:号称千万级的IP池,我真的能用到那么多吗?
A: “千万级IP池”意味着服务商拥有庞大的资源储备和调度能力。你实际使用的并发数可能远小于此,但这保证了你在需要时有充足的IP资源可供调度,避免了因IP资源枯竭导致业务中断。特别是当业务量增长或需要应对高强度采集任务时,庞大的纯净IP池是业务连续性的坚实后盾。
全球领先动态住宅IP服务商-神龙海外代理
使用方法:注册账号→联系客服免费试用→购买需要的套餐→前往不同的场景使用代理IP

